my front passenger door got pushed forward and then dented in my front fender. i was checking out some other xj's and say a few others like that, is that a common problem? or am i just lucky. if it is common, is there an easy way to fix the door? TIA
 
Hinge failure on XJ's, especially 2-doors, is pretty common. If the hinge is tearing away where it is welded to the unibody, it can be rewelded, but to do it right requires that the door and fender come off. When the door gets far enough out of alignment, it will catch on the edge of the fender. Sometimes you can adjust the door on the hinge, or just bang it back toward the body, but it's likely that the only real fix will be to repair the weld. If the door check is broken, you can replace that, and it will help keep the door from opening out too far and denting things. The check mechanism is not strong enough for the weight of the 2-door if it is flung open, and will often even bend out the frame of the door where it is mounted. When this happens, the hinges reach their built-in limit stops, and flex out from the body, eventually fatiguing the welds.
 
There are also two repair/reinforcement packages Jeep has come out with for the door hinges on 84-97. Which one to use depends on how much weld seperation there is. If the seperation is less than 75% then you use part #5083060AA. If it is more than 75% you use part # 5083061AA. These require removing the door to fix.

What does the repair package do? Any welding, ...?
Kai
 
No welding just hammering the hinge close to the body (if it pulled away), drilling and riveting/bolting in some reinforcement brackets. Depending on the kit used you would have to pull the door to install the more severe kit.

Kaivi, make sure your problem is not simply a broken door check, or broekn metal around the door check. If it fails the door will open too much and make contact as well.
